Job summary

Archer, an aerospace company in San Jose, CA, seeks a Safety Engineer to lead risk assessments and design safety controls across powertrain systems. You will develop standards, review designs, and guide incident investigations to ensure regulatory compliance and safe operations.

Collaboration with design, validation, and manufacturing teams is essential. Requirements include a Bachelor’s or Master’s in Mechanical, Electrical, Mechatronics, or Safety Engineering and 3+ years in safety roles

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Mechatronics, or Safety Engineering (or related field).
  • 3+ years of experience in a safety engineering role, preferably with a focus on powertrain systems.
  • Knowledge of functional safety standards (ISO 26262, IEC 61508, etc.).
  • Experience with industrial equipment, safety controls, and risk mitigation techniques.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ct risk assessments and safety analyses (e.g., FMEA, HAZOP, FTA) on powertrain systems and test equipment
  • Develop and implement safety standards, policies, and procedures in accordance with applicable regulations (e.g., OSHA, ISO 26262, ISO 13849)
  • Collaborate with design, validation, and manufacturing teams to ensure safety is embedded in all stages of equipment lifecycle.
  • Review mechanical, electrical, and software designs for safety compliance
  • Lead incident investigations and root cause analyses related to powertrain equipment
  • Specify and validate safety systems (e.g., emergency stop systems, interlocks, guarding)
  • Support equipment commissioning, maintenance planning, and safety audits
  • Document safety protocols, create reports, and provide training to engineering and operations teams
